Luxury Interior Remodel in Manhattan Beach | Walk Streets Project

Modern Design with Spanish-Inspired Touches

Located in the highly desirable Walk Streets of Manhattan Beach, this recently completed luxury interior remodel blends contemporary sophistication with subtle Spanish-style architectural influences. Although just moments from the ocean, the home moves beyond typical coastal design, embracing warm materials, arched forms, and refined finishes that create a timeless, elevated atmosphere.

Modern Luxury with Spanish-Inspired Architecture

From the moment you enter, the home sets the tone with warm, wide-plank wood flooring that runs throughout the interior. These natural tones provide the perfect backdrop for the home’s modern lines, while the repeated use of arched passageways introduces a nod to classic Spanish architecture.

The arches soften transitions between spaces and are carried into several bathrooms, where they frame the shower entrances and add continuity across the home. This mix of structure and curve creates a balanced design that feels both contemporary and timeless.

Italian Cabinetry in This Manhattan Beach Luxury Interior Remodel

A defining feature of this Manhattan Beach remodel is the use of luxury Italian cabinetry throughout the home, including the kitchen, dry bar, bathroom vanities, closets, and custom built-ins. The kitchen pairs sleek European styling with high performance, featuring integrated Miele appliances for a clean, seamless look.

Select upper cabinets include glass fronts with interior backlighting, adding depth and visual interest while highlighting the craftsmanship behind each piece. The result is a kitchen that feels both refined and highly functional—perfect for entertaining and everyday living.

Custom Closets, Built-Ins & Lighting Details

Storage spaces were elevated well beyond the ordinary. Custom closets and built-ins feature integrated strip lighting, improving functionality while adding a luxurious, boutique-like feel.

Lighting plays a major role throughout the home. Decorative sconces and chandeliers, including fixtures with onyx shades, bring warmth and elegance to each room. These layered lighting elements complement the natural daylight pouring in from multiple skylights across the property.

Texture, Tile & Concreta Plaster Finishes

Intricate tile designs are showcased in kitchens and bathrooms, adding personality and craftsmanship to each space. To further enhance the modern aesthetic, Concreta plaster was applied throughout select areas, including the bathrooms and the dramatic living room focal wall.

The subtle texture of the plaster provides visual depth while maintaining a soft, organic appearance, another detail that bridges modern design with Spanish-inspired materiality.

Living Room Fireplace Feature

The living room centers around a stunning architectural statement: a fireplace wrapped in large-format stone slab, with Concreta plaster extending from the surround all the way to the ceiling. This vertical treatment draws the eye upward, grounding the room with texture and scale while reinforcing the home’s luxurious yet comfortable ambiance.

Staircase, Skylights & Architectural Highlights

One of the most striking moments in the home occurs at the staircase. A custom metal railing with decorative knuckle-designed balusters provides a modern contrast while maintaining openness between levels.

Above, four skylights surround a central chandelier, flooding the space with natural light and creating a dramatic focal point. Additional skylights throughout the home enhance the airy, coastal-meets-Spanish feel while reducing the need for artificial lighting during the day.
